Les Hôtels Tufenkian accueillent des réunions d'affaires d’ampleur différente : à partir des séances de réflexion avec deux ou trois personnes, jusqu’aux formations d’une semaine pour soixante-dix personnes et plus. Le choix de l’emplacement prévu pour les séminaires et les conférences stimule l’efficacité du travail et en même temps est idéal pour la détente. Chaque hôtel bénéficie d’une localisation qui permet largement de profiter de l’environnement naturel d’Arménie en minimisant l’impact des distractions.

Les salles de conférence disposent d’une large gamme d’équipements technologiques. Notre équipe culinaire coordonne avec vous le menu des repas et des rafraîchissements afin de fournir aux participants une cuisine de haute qualité. Les participants profiteront du luxe exquis et du service dignes de la renommée d’hôtels Tufekian.
Les salles de conférence fournissent un espace modulable répondant à toutes les exigences: conférences, formations, présentations, projections. Les hôtels Tufenkian pensent à tous les détails de votre événement corporatif. Les différentes activités de loisirs et les installations sportives aident le voyageur d’affaires à être en forme pour le travail du lendemain. Les petites salles de réunion sont à la fois idéales pour des courtes rencontres et confortables pour des discussions animées.
